Drama\u201d that serves as the film\u2019s crux is that, ahead of the wedding between Robert Pattinson and Zendaya\u2019s characters, Zendaya\u2019s character Emma reveals that she once planned a school shooting when she was a young teen. The confession is shared during a dinner with friends, who each share the worst thing they\u2019ve ever done. Emma notes that her plan included practicing with a firearm to the point that it blew out her ear drum in one ear, writing and videoing a manifesto (seen in flashbacks), and even bringing the rifle to school. She, crucially, never carried through with the act.<\/p>\n<p>The revelation rocks the impending nuptials and causes Pattinson\u2019s character Charlie to rethink everything. Last week, Tom Mauser, whose son was killed in the Columbine High School shooting in 1999, spoke to <a rel=\"nofollow\" data-id=\"https:\/\/www.tmz.com\/2026\/03\/24\/zendaya-the-drama-called-out-by-columbine-parent\/\" data-type=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.tmz.com\/2026\/03\/24\/zendaya-the-drama-called-out-by-columbine-parent\/\" target=\"_blank\">TMZ<\/a> and told the outlet he thought it was \u201cawful\u201d the film used that idea as a twist. He was also bothered by what he perceived to be Zendaya laughing off the plot point during a recent appearance on \u201cJimmy Kimmel Live.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>As a survivor herself, Corin sympathized with Mauser\u2019s experience and understood that, for him and others, gun violence is not a theoretical fear.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I\u2019m not going to see the film personally, because I know that in the film there are flashbacks, and those will bring up really intense and hard feelings for me as a survivor that I am choosing to opt out of,\u201d she said. \u201cHe was so valid for sharing that he found the premise awful, because I think engaging with gun violence in the movie with a framing of humor and irony does require the off screen conversations to engage with it with seriousness and intention, but that balance was not met.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Corin said A24 is an expert at building intrigue for a film, protecting a film\u2019s revelations, and making that a part of their brand. Yet she believes there were ways the marketing team could have still signaled the film\u2019s emotional turns more clearly or made audiences aware of its theme without fully revealing the plot. But, in this instance, hoping people would just enjoy the plot point when it comes to something so personal, is \u201ctoo much ambiguity can feel like a misdirect.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Moving forward, she points A24 to another gun violence prevention organization called Brady that advises Hollywood types on how to showcase safe gun use and stories of violence in films. But she also says that A24 should not \u201cgo silent or double down\u201d and should instead engage in a larger conversation. <\/p>\n<p>\u201cI\u2019d acknowledge the concern directly, not defensively, but just a clear recognition that people are having this reaction, because it\u2019s real. When families and survivors are expressing discomfort, that should be met with respect,\u201d Corin said. \u201cOffering more clarity on tone and intent, giving audiences a better sense of what the film is actually trying to do.
